The Bauerfeind MalleoLoc Ankle Brace is engineered to stabilize the ankle after injuries while allowing for natural movement. Its unique design keeps the heel and front of the foot free, ensuring comfort and mobility. Ideal for treating severe sprains and chronic instabilities, this brace features a secure Velcro strapping system for easy wear and effective support.

this brace works period. it gives the support where my foot needs it, and permits good enough movement in the plane that does not need support.i am a basketball player, and i developed a Posterior Tibialis tendonitis from several ankle sprains. and my ankle was hurting as hell for 6 months, nagging pain. no fracture, just wear and tear of the tendon. so the my Orthopedic Doctor prescribed me this Malleoloc brace, and in 2 - 3 weeks time of bracing it and of course i rested away from basketball in those weeks, and it is all good now.the Good thing about this brace is that, aside from the things i mentioned in my first statement, it fits well inside the shoe! the ankle braces i bought in walmart before, the foam with velcro does not fit good inside the shoe. sure you can fit it if you adjust the laces but when you run and play i felt uncomfortable with it especially on the arches.with this Malleoloc, it holds the sides of your ankle but in the arches it is not bulky. and i can play basketball with this one on my ankle.BUY IT!Cons: price - but you get what you pay for, quality materials

Comfortable, light, low-profile ankle brace giving excellent support for a weak ankle
I used this ankle brace years ago while recovering from a bad ankle sprain. It is very comfortable, light and not too bulky, fitting in sneakers and loose flats. It gives excellent support and I was able to walk through sand dunes on a trip to Jordan with no damage to my still fragile ankle. I recently purchased the right ankle version due to severely spraining my other ankle. It wasn't useful at first as there was too much swelling for it to fit comfortably and tightly but now that the swelling has mostly gone down I am finding it excellent support now that I have come out of a full walking boot and becoming mobile again despite my ankle still being extremely weak.
